    Comillas 2.0 In his book The Image of the City (1960), Kevin Lynch coined the term “wayfinding” to describe his concept of environmental legibility that is, the elements of the built environment that allow us to navigate successfully through complex spaces like cities and towns. The most fundamental underlying metaphor of the World Wide Web  is navigation through a space populated  by places we call web “sites,” and thus  the wayfinding metaphor is  perfect for thinking about web navigation.
